Was bedeutet O Notation?

Was bedeutet O Notation?

Landau-Symbole (auch O-Notation, englisch big O notation) werden in der Mathematik und in der Informatik verwendet, um das asymptotische Verhalten von Funktionen und Folgen zu beschreiben.

Warum gibt man die Laufzeit von Algorithmen in der O Notation an?

Die 𝒪-Notation gibt keinen exakten Wert an, sondern stellt eine Abschätzung dar, basierend auf der Konstruktion des verwendeten Algorithmus. 𝒪(1) konstante Komplexität, die Laufzeit hängt nicht von der Datenmenge ab.

Wie ist eine Definition von einem Algorithmus?

Folglich ist eine Definition immer sehr allgemein und liest sich je nach Quelle ein wenig unterschiedlich. Grundsätzlich handelt es sich bei einem Algorithmus um eine formal festgelegte Vorgehensweise, nach der eine definierte Aufgabe gemäß einem strukturierten Schema gelöst wird.

Ist ein Algorithmus eine Bildungsvorschrift?

Um die Frage mal schnell zu beantworten lässt sich ganz einfach sagen: ein Algorithmus ist eine genaue Bildungsvorschrift. Du kannst ihn mit einem Rezept oder eine Bauanleitung vergleichen, denn er ist nicht mehr als das. Besser gesagt sind sogar beides Algorithmen. Ganz so einfach lasse ich das aber nicht stehen.

Was ist ein nicht-terminierender Algorithmus?

Ein nicht-terminierender Algorithmus (somit zu keinem Ergebnis kommend) gerät (für manche Eingaben) in eine so genannte Endlosschleife. Für manche Abläufe ist ein nicht-terminierendes Verhalten gewünscht: Z. B. Steuerungssysteme, Betriebssysteme und Programme, die auf Interaktion mit dem Benutzer…

Warum sind Algorithmen nichts Neues?

Dabei sind Algorithmen nichts Neues. Bereits in seinem Buch „über die indischen Ziffern“ aus dem 9. Jahrhundert erklärt der arabische Mathematiker Al-Chwarismi (der Namensgeber des Algorithmus), den Gebrauch indischer Zahlzeichen. Eine neue Dimension der Anwendung erfährt der Algorithmus allerdings im Bereich Big Data bzw.

Beginne damit, deinen Suchbegriff oben einzugeben und drücke Enter für die Suche. Drücke ESC, um abzubrechen.

Zurück nach oben